All Things Killingworth Town Picnic October 5th

Submitted by All Things Killingworth

(July 23, 2024) — The community is invited to the All Things Killingworth Town Picnic, which will take place on October 5, 2024 with the first band starting at 2:00 p.m. at Deer Lake in Killingworth. This event promises a full day of fun, food and festivities for all ages, designed to bring together the residents of Killingworth in a celebration of community spirit.

This event has something for everyone, from live music, vendors and non-profits to delicious food and engaging activities. Don’t miss out on this opportunity to celebrate the spirit of Killingworth with friends and neighbors.

The full schedule and vendor announcements can be found at https://allthingskillingworth.com/killingworth-town-picnic/. We are continually adding new vendors, sponsors and entertainment so stay tuned on the website or through Facebook.

Proceeds from the Event Will Benefit:

  • Homes for the Brave: The first and only community-based transitional home exclusively for Women Veterans experiencing homelessness and their young children in Connecticut.
  • Deer Lake Camp Scholarship: Providing scholarships for children to attend Deer Lake summer camp.
